Transaction 02d01a32ef1732756395fc75e97cf0f686cce851075f7742bde9b0bd7f14f644

3 Input
2 Outputs
  • 02d01a32ef1732756395fc75e97cf0f686cce851075f7742bde9b0bd7f14f644:0
  • value  2634588
    address  3Pkur6e3EsQKZmytAsaxLpQ4UqmTBg3jAw
  • 02d01a32ef1732756395fc75e97cf0f686cce851075f7742bde9b0bd7f14f644:1
  • value  38510902
    address  14bmfBDe3H7b5WEi6gKY6LvSdHP3RxLwRn